Located near the bay, The Ardilaun Hotel offers a tranquil retreat with a garden and coffee shop. Guests can unwind in the sauna or steam room, enjoy al fresco dining at one of two restaurants, or connect to WiFi. With helpful staff on hand and amenities like an indoor pool and dry cleaning services.
When you stay at The Ardilaun Hotel, you'll be just a 5-minute drive from Quay Street and Eyre Square. Guests can take a dip in the indoor pool or grab a bite to eat at Camilaun Restaurant, which is one of 2 restaurants and serves breakfast and dinner. Other features include a bar/lounge, a fitness center, and a sauna. Fellow travelers love the helpful staff.

Shocked at checkin
When we first checked in we received a room that was still occupied. We walked into the room and a lady was in bed sleeping. This was a shocking experience and I cannot imagine her horror waking up with us looking at her. It was absolutely unacceptable. The receptionist that made the error didn't even apologise for the mistake nor provide anything complimentary for this dismal behavior, although she said that we would receive something complimentary for her lack of excellence. We then received a room that was without shower gel during our stay. The shower was also badly insulated and the towels was drenched with water each time we showered. The staff at the restaurant was super friendly and food was exceptional. All in all... It truly was a socking experience when we checked in and we wont be back.
